- [ ] **Step 7: Breaker override escrow.** After sealing the signing keys for the Tallgrove upstream API circuit breaker, confirm the support team can force the breaker open during a full outage. The override bundle lives in the sealed escrow drawer and is useless without its unlock phrase. Two ceremony witnesses must initial this step before proceeding. The escrow bundle is decrypted with the recovery passphrase that follows.

vault phrase of kahip-kahop = holath-quenmir

Nightly reindex for Quillbase search kicks off at 02:15 and usually finishes in forty minutes. If it's still running past 04:00, check the crawler queue before restarting anything — duplicate runs corrupt the shard map. Don't panic about the warning spam; it's cosmetic. Step-by-step recovery instructions are kept on the internal wiki page below.

operations page: https://jenkins.zemvarcloud.local/job/merge_requests/repo/build/73930b4b30f0a8ed

Subject: Memtrace cut-over — done

Hi all — welcome aboard. We finished moving GPU memory profiling from the old Gaugeling scripts to Memtrace last night. Allocation snapshots, leak diffs, and per-kernel breakdowns all live in one place now. New folks: just point your jobs at the profiler daemon. It starts with the config below.

deployment values, bahof-badug:
[rusix]
team = zorok
access_code = ac_641cbe
owner = ulair.tamius
host = rusix.torvasoft.local
port = 5672
peer = ulaix.sivrelworks.internal
salt = 1df570ed
pin = 6327

This PR rolls out the Quillbank consent banner to all Harrowgate-tier tenants behind the `consent_v2` flag. Rollout is staged at 5%, 25%, then 100%; each stage holds for two hours. If dismissal-rate alerts fire, flip the flag off — no redeploy needed. Copy changes were approved by the Merrow policy team. On-call should watch the banner latency dashboard. The stage timings and thresholds are defined here.

tuning constants:
QUOTAS = {
    "druwyn": 5,
    "holix": 5,
    "zorath": 5,
    "holwyn": 10,
}